 A drunk man who had run berserk driving a digger machine in South Iceland had to be stopped by police and his vehicle overturned. He was transported to a hospital in Reykjavik via helicopter. 

Police had received a phonecall that the man was driving around in a crazy manner in a Caterpillar digger vehicle weighing two tonnes near his home. Police tried to signal to the man to stop the vehicle but he did not respond. Police chased him and drove across the road to stop the vehicle with the above consequences. 

According to police the man posed danger to traffic due to his erratic driving behaviour. 

The man's injuries are not serious and he is recovering at hospital.
